How To Improve Communication In The Workplace


How To Improve Communication In The Workplace

In today’s fast-paced and increasingly interconnected business world, effective communication is no longer a luxury but a necessity for organizational success. Poor communication can lead to misunderstandings, decreased productivity, and even fractured working relationships, ultimately impacting the bottom line.

This article delves into practical strategies and techniques for improving communication within the workplace, drawing on expert insights and best practices. We will explore how fostering a culture of open dialogue, embracing technological tools, and providing targeted training can significantly enhance communication flow and create a more collaborative and productive work environment.

Building a Foundation of Open Communication

Creating a culture of open communication starts at the top. Leaders must model transparent and honest communication, setting the tone for the entire organization.

According to a study by Gallup, employees who feel their opinions are heard are nearly five times more likely to feel a sense of empowerment. This highlights the importance of actively soliciting feedback from employees at all levels.

One strategy is to implement regular town hall meetings or open forums where employees can ask questions and share their concerns directly with leadership. Anonymous feedback mechanisms, such as suggestion boxes or online surveys, can also provide a safe space for employees to voice their opinions without fear of reprisal.

Leveraging Technology for Enhanced Communication

Technology plays a crucial role in facilitating communication in the modern workplace. From email and instant messaging to video conferencing and project management software, a plethora of tools are available to streamline communication processes.

However, it is important to select the right tools for the specific needs of the organization and to provide employees with adequate training on how to use them effectively. Over-reliance on email can lead to information overload and delayed responses, so consider using instant messaging for quick questions and project management software for collaborative tasks.

Slack and Microsoft Teams, for example, offer channels for different projects or teams, allowing for focused communication and reduced inbox clutter. Video conferencing platforms like Zoom or Google Meet can facilitate face-to-face interactions, even when employees are geographically dispersed.

Investing in Communication Training and Development

Even with the right tools and a supportive culture, effective communication requires specific skills. Communication training can equip employees with the knowledge and techniques they need to communicate clearly, concisely, and respectfully.

Training programs can cover a range of topics, including active listening, nonverbal communication, conflict resolution, and cross-cultural communication. Active listening, for instance, involves paying close attention to what the speaker is saying, both verbally and nonverbally, and responding in a way that shows understanding and empathy.

Furthermore, employees should be trained on how to give and receive constructive feedback.

"Feedback is a gift,"
as the saying goes, but it must be delivered in a way that is helpful and encouraging, rather than critical or accusatory. Regular workshops and online courses can help employees hone their communication skills and stay up-to-date on best practices.

Addressing Communication Barriers

Several barriers can hinder effective communication in the workplace, including language differences, cultural misunderstandings, and personal biases. Organizations should take steps to address these barriers and create a more inclusive and equitable communication environment.

Providing language training for employees who are not native speakers can help them communicate more confidently and effectively. Cultural sensitivity training can raise awareness of cultural differences and promote understanding and respect.

Addressing unconscious biases is also crucial. Unconscious biases are implicit attitudes and stereotypes that can affect how we perceive and interact with others. Training programs can help employees identify their own biases and learn strategies for mitigating their impact on communication.

The Lasting Impact of Improved Communication

Investing in improved workplace communication yields significant benefits, including increased employee engagement, enhanced productivity, and stronger team cohesion. When employees feel heard and understood, they are more likely to be motivated and committed to their work.

Effective communication also reduces the risk of misunderstandings and errors, leading to improved efficiency and quality. By fostering a culture of open dialogue, embracing technology, and providing targeted training, organizations can create a more collaborative and productive work environment where everyone thrives.

Ultimately, improved communication is not just about transmitting information; it is about building relationships, fostering trust, and creating a shared understanding that drives organizational success.
